GENERAL DESCRIPTION OF POSITION
The Operator 1 position is responsible for the proper preparation, cleaning loading, inspection and running of parts in 1-4 production machines with frequent supervision. Works from written instructions, work orders, standard programs, and instructions given by the supervisor or lead.
REQUIREMENTS:
High school diploma or GED Required
6 months experience in a manufacturing environment
Ability to read and comprehend verbal and written instructions in English
Ability to add, subtract, multiply, divide all units of measure including common and decimal fractions
Basic familiarity with mechanical drawings/blueprints
Vision and depth perception suitable for use of handheld inspection tools
Willingness to wear finger cots, masks, and/or clean-room apparel
Ability to either stand or walk for extended periods of shift
Ability to bend, push, pull, reach, grab, turn, twist, and/or stoop
Ability to grab small parts or hand tools with hands
Ability to lift and/or carry up to 30 lbs. depending on the specific function.
Eligible to work in an ITAR environment
